

Mark Wright Millard, of Modesto, California, passed away on August 31, 2016.He was born in Modesto on October 17, 1960, youngest son of the late Harry and Virginia Millard. He attended the public schools of Modesto and graduated from Thomas Downey High School in 1979. After graduation, Mark entered the United States Air Force and served for three years. He received an Associate of Applied Science from ITT in 1990 and spent several years employed as a project manager for ADT, Simplex Grinnell, and Seimans . Five years ago he became an electrical contractor and started his own business, M&M Electric. And, most recently, he was employed by Sabah International.
